Realme GT 6 colour variants for India revealed; China-exclusive model also in the works

Highlights
  • Realme GT 6 is launching globally and in India on June 20th.
  • The smartphone is expected to be a rebrand of the GT Neo 6.
  • Realme is also tipped to launch a China-exclusive GT 6 model.

The Realme GT 6 India launch date was revealed just yesterday. The new GT smartphone is also making its global debut on the same day. So far Realme has teased the GT 6 as its ‘AI Flagship Killer’ smartphone but no other details have been revealed. Now, the Realme GT 6 colour variants in India have been revealed. Another leak talks about a China-exclusive Realme GT 6 in the works, and this one will feature the flagship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chipset.

Realme GT 6 colour variants

  • Realme GT 6 will come in three colour options: Green, Purple, and Silver, according to tipster Mukul Sharma.
  • This leak also confirms that the Realme GT 6 is indeed a rebrand of the Realme GT Neo 6 that’s available in China. It’s the same design and colour variants as well.
  • Realme GT Neo 6 is the brand’s first Snapdragon 8s Gen 3-powered smartphone and it has been launched at a starting price of CNY 2,099 (Rs 24,700 approx).

Realme GT 6: what to expect

If the Realme GT 6 is indeed the global version of the GT Neo 6, then it could come with a 6.78-inch FHD+ 120Hz AMOLED display, and with up to 16GB RAM and 1TB onboard storage. The smartphone is expected to house a 50MP primary sensor, an 8MP ultra-wide camera and a 32MP front camera. It could also pack a 5,500mAh battery with 120W SuperVOOC fast charging technology.

Realme has already teased AI on the GT 6, and these features could be AI Smart Loop, AI Night Vision, AI Smart Removal and AI Smart Search (Circle to Search).

Realme GT 6 China-exclusive model

Realme is reportedly working on a China-exclusive model of the GT 6. This is a more powerful version with the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chipset, a 6,000mAh battery with 100W fast charging support. The Realme GT 6 Chinese version is also tipped to feature a BOE-supplied S1 display with a 1.5K resolution, a 50MP primary sensor, and a metal middle frame. Realme is expected to launch GT 6 smartphone in China this month or early July.
